PGR is a seriously good racing game. It is more fun than GT3 (which I also own) since you are rewarded for powerslides, 360s, 2 wheeling and catching air.
The Cooper S is the car of choice for the first levels and only becomes redundant when you get the Focus Rally car.
The car handles like real life. Sharp turn-in, little body-roll, excellent weight transferance and good brakes.
